What active ingredient does “generic Natroba” need to match?

Any true generic would need to contain the same active ingredient as Natroba (spinosad) and be approved as therapeutically equivalent for the same indication (scabies). If a product is using spinosad but is marketed under a different formulation or approval pathway, it may not be interchangeable in practice the way a fully approved generic would be.

Why would a “generic Natroba” launch be delayed?

For topical products like spinosad, launch timing is usually tied to the status of:
- patents listed for the brand,
- potential periods of exclusivity (which can extend beyond the first patent),
